Add --dry-run option to pip install #11096

This options simply prints what pip would install instead of actually installing.

The output is human readable and mimics what an actual pip install prints.
It is not intended to be parsed by tools: that will be added by the --report option which will produce a rich json output.

Towards #53 and #10771.

@pradyunsg It is not entirely clear to me there was a clear consensus in #53, which is a very long thread. And #10748 shows that other people understood it as an extension of pip download.

But yes I am proposing that instead of pip resolve, we allow the composition of 3 pip install options: --dry-run, --report and --ignore-installed to the same effect, and more. It is IMO easy to understand, relatively simple to implement, and a more versatile superset of what a new pip resolve command would do. @uranusjr actually it looks like the legacy resolver retunrs already installed requirements, and they are filtered out later by resolver.get_installation_order.

So yeah, this discrepancy is annoying and I think I'll make --dry-run error out when used with the legacy resolver, because I don't think refactoring legacy resolver code paths is worthwhile at this point.
